What Is the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ern

The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ern is defined by its distinctive construction method. Instead of working evenly around all sides, the square grows using mitered corners, which form sharp angles and diagonal lines. This technique gives the square a structured, architectural appearance that sets it apart from traditional designs.

At the center of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ern, a floral motif is typically created using circular rounds. This flower acts as the focal point, drawing the eye inward before the design expands outward into the mitered square shape. The contrast between the soft flower and the strong angles creates visual depth.

One of the key benefits of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ern is its clean and modern aesthetic. The mitered edges produce straight, crisp lines that align beautifully when multiple squares are joined together. This makes it especially popular for larger projects that require precision.

The pattern is also highly adaptable. The flower can be simple or detailed, depending on stitch choices and yarn selection. Similarly, the mitered sections can be expanded with additional rounds to create larger squares.

Because of its structured build, the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ern often lays flatter than some traditional granny squares. This makes it easier to assemble into blankets or other flat projects without excessive blocking.

Materials and Yarn Choices for Best Results

Selecting the right materials is essential for achieving the best outcome with the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ern. Yarn choice plays a major role in defining the clarity of the mitered lines and the softness of the flower motif. Yarns with good stitch definition are particularly effective for highlighting the pattern’s structure.

Medium-weight yarns are commonly used, as they provide balance between durability and flexibility. However, lighter yarns can create delicate, airy squares, while heavier yarns result in bold, cozy designs. The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ern adapts well to different yarn weights when tension is consistent.

Hook size should complement the yarn while maintaining firm stitches. A slightly smaller hook can help emphasize the sharp angles of the mitered corners, ensuring the square keeps its shape.

Color selection is another important consideration. Many crocheters choose contrasting colors to separate the flower from the square, making the central motif stand out. Others prefer tonal palettes for a more subtle and cohesive appearance.

Blocking is highly recommended when working with the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ern. Proper blocking enhances the square’s geometry, sharpens corners, and ensures uniform size across multiple squares.

Finally, keeping tools consistent throughout the project helps maintain even results. Using the same hook, yarn brand, and tension ensures that all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ern units align perfectly when assembled.

Tips for Mastering and Customizing the Pattern

Mastering the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ern begins with understanding the mitered technique itself. Practicing the corner turns separately can help build confidence before committing to a full square.

Consistency is key when working on multiple squares. Maintaining even tension ensures that each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ern piece remains uniform in size and shape.

Customization is one of the pattern’s greatest strengths. Changing the number of flower petals, adding textured stitches, or adjusting the number of mitered rounds can dramatically alter the final look.

Color experimentation can also transform the pattern. Using bold contrasts emphasizes the geometric structure, while soft gradients create a more organic and calming effect.

Keeping track of stitch counts is especially important in the mitered sections. Accurate counting helps maintain symmetry and prevents distortion in the square.

FAQ –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ern

Is the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ern suitable for beginners?
The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ern is approachable for beginners who are comfortable with basic stitches, though the mitered technique may require some practice.

What type of yarn works best for this pattern?
Yarns with good stitch definition work best for the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ern, as they highlight both the flower and the mitered edges.

How do I keep my squares perfectly square?
Consistent tension, accurate stitch counts, and blocking help maintain the shape of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ern.

Can I adjust the size of the square?
Yes, adding or removing rounds in the mitered section allows you to customize the size of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ern.

Is this pattern good for large projects like blankets?
Absolutely. The structured design of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ern makes it ideal for large, seamless projects.

What joining method works best?
Invisible or flat joins often complement the clean lines of the Mitered Flower Granny Square Pattern beautifully.
